Wedding Photography 

It was a great time for us to photo and film this super photogenic couple.  

The rain didn't actually bother them much. Mel and Tim were so laidback and laughing all the time, and directions were barely needed.  

The photos turned out really natural and fun, which reflects their real personalities. 

The rain actually helped a lot with the result of their wedding photos. The mists brought out colours and contrasts from the grass and leaves, also adding a lot of mood to the pictures. 

  

The sun came out the last minute, so we were lucky to have the opportunity to seal the portraits with some fantastic sunset photos.  

  

The Venue 

Base in the magnificent Yarra Valley. Wandin Park Estate features the countryside charm, natural setting, and breathtaking view of rolling hills. The 320 acres of land offers unlimited wedding photo opportunities.  

  

The Woolshed at the Wandin Park Estate is a unique, rustic and charming venue for wedding receptions of all sizes. The historic timber features, French doors, and exposed ceiling beams add to the rustic charm that has been established throughout the decades. They simply can't be found in modern wedding venues.
